Share passages from kindle paperwhite

I have a few personal documents on my kindle paperwhite. If i want to share the highlighted areas from the text on Facebook , it wont let me. I converted the document with calibre , clicked the sharing option,edited the ASIN also with metaeditor ,cdtype - EDOC....but it wont work. I am getting an email from amazon with an error message. How can i manage to share the text i want? Thank you

I doubt it is available for pdocs, as the sharing is part of public notes / highlights. Thus limited to purchased (including free) kindle-books. And some books might have that feature disabled.

You can share passages from personal docs on Facebook. I do it on occasion, but I never use calibre to create my books, I use Kindle Previewer and then Send To Kindle to put them in the Cloud. The error might be a calibre issue or it might be a side load issue as I'm not sure if side loaded books can share passages.
